Octave Klaba returns as OVHcloud CEO

in News
Octave Klaba returns as OVHcloud CEO
Share on LinkedinShare on WhatsApp

Octave Klaba, founder of OVHcloud, has taken back his role as CEO starting immediately, after the board decided to combine the chairman and CEO roles.

Klaba led the company from its founding in 1999 until 2018, then became chairman. His return to the CEO position will end Benjamin Revcolevschi’s term.

Today, Klaba told investors, “We are launching our new five-year Strategic Plan, during which our customers will be able to benefit from the last 10 years of massive investments, first in data centers and then in software. In the coming months, I will present our 2026-2030 strategic plan, “Step Ahead,” to guide our teams and support our customers, while generating value for our shareholders.”

Pierre Barrial, Lead Director and Chairman of the Remunerations and Nominations Committee, commented: “Octave Klaba will lead the Group with determination and agility, as he has done during OVHcloud’s most decisive years, in a context that requires vision, rigorous execution, and innovation capacities. In a rapidly growing cloud market, his expertise, knowledge of the company, and understanding of customer and industry trends will enable OVHcloud to implement its strategic plan and build an operational roadmap for the coming years.”

The leadership shuffle comes as OHVcloud reported a 9.3% increase in revenue to 1.08 billion euros for fiscal year 2025.

For 2026, OVHcloud aims for organic revenue growth of 5% to 7%, below this year’s 9.3%, as it works to strengthen its Webcloud segment.
